Game 121 Preview: Stripling vs Winckowski

After a successful trip into Yankee Stadium, the Blue Jays head to Fenway Park in search of some more much needed wins, as they open a three game set against theRoss Stripling will head to the mound to make his second start since coming back from his short stint on the Injured List. In his return last week, he was phenomenal, throwing 6.1 shutout innings, including setting down the first 18 batters he faced and carrying a perfect game into the 7th inning.

The 24 year old righty has thrown 60.2 innings at the big league level this year, pitching to a 5-6 record with a 5.19 ERA. His FIP is right there as well, coming in at 5.21. The walk rate and home run rate are close enough to league average that it’s not notable, but the high FIP comes from a ridiculously low K rate of just 5.34 per 9 innings. Of the 164 pitchers who have thrown at least 60 innings, just 6 of them have a lower K rate.

On the topic of foul balls taking a player out, Teoscar Hernández fouled a ball off his foot on Saturday, but was back in the lineup Sunday as DH. Hopefully the day off yesterday gave him a good opportunity to rest it up some more.Trevor Story, with his fractured wrist, is the only member of the Red Sox’ offensive unit currently on the IL. He is taking some batting practice at the moment, and is likely getting close to heading out on a rehab assignment.
